Joint tenancy - An estate in cotenancy that must not only be specified in the grant, but also requires three “unities.” All joint tenants must receive title in the same conveyance, beginning at the same time, and with undivided possession.

Joint tenants -
Persons who own an estate in joint tenancy.

Judgment -
The decision of a court regarding the rights of parties in an action.

Junior mortgage -
A mortgage lower in lien priority than another, for example, a second mortgage or home equity line.
